Hi all,
a brief update on the porting status to 5.4:
- new noarch ipipe/master is ready:
https://gitlab.denx.de/Xenomai/ipipe-noarch/-/commits/ipipe/master
I've regenerated the queue from Fino's work, reviewing conflict
resolutions once again. No issues found, well done! I've only done a
few cleanups and added missing patches from the latest 4.19-noarch.
This should now be a reasonable baseline for porting other archs.
- x86 5.4 branch is also ready:
https://gitlab.denx.de/Xenomai/ipipe-x86/-/commits/ipipe-x86-5.4.y
Here I added the FPU changes, fixing the hard-irqs mask leak and
hardening an additionally needed path (fpu__clear). I've also done a
full merge conflict review, and I think I found and fixed issues in
the kvm code. Still untested, though. I've cleaned up the GTOD update.
I furthermore fixed missing hard-irqs reenabling in some page-fault
paths. And added latest x86 patches from 4.19.
- Xenomai next is almost ready:
https://gitlab.denx.de/Xenomai/xenomai/-/commits/next
RTnet and Analogy are not building ATM. That still breaks CI. But the
result is otherwise working fine, at least in QEMU/KVM. More tests
welcome!
